This is the new Riese and Müller Multitinker, the ultimate Compact Electric Cargo Bike! In this video, we’ll take a closer look at this amazing bike and see how it performs as the ultimate urban commuter.
The Riese and Müller Multitinker is a compact cargo bike that is designed to carry heavy loads and make your daily commute a breeze. It comes equipped with a variety of accessories that make it suitable for pretty much anything. Whether you need to transport groceries, cargo, equipment, or even a child, the Multitinker has you covered.
This bike has a sleek and modern design that’s both sturdy and easy to maneuver. If you're in the market for a new electric cargo bike, then the Riese and Müller Multitinker is definitely worth considering. It's a compact and versatile bike that is perfect for urban commuting, and its high-quality components and design make it a joy to ride.

@margaretcarpenter8472
@margaretcarpenter8472 Жыл бұрын
I owned two Gazelle bikes, including the C380 plus. I sold mine and bought the Multitinker--its totally different ride. I got the sport tires. The gazelle is a great bike and its lighter but the Multitinker is a long tail cargo, it has weight capacity of 450lbs, its low to the ground and has 20 inch tires with a totally different center of gravity and can haul heavy loads and adult passengers. The battery on the Multtitinker is also larger at 650w.
